After eight years in space, BepiColombo is approaching the most demanding stage of its journey to Mercury. On Thursday, Sept. 3, the spacecraft’s two probes are due to separate from their transport module.

Ignacio Tanco, ESA’s flight director for the mission, says the separation will be a major challenge because it resembles launching a new spacecraft, except that it will happen around another planet. And separation will only open the next chapter of the mission’s difficulties.

Mercury offers an exceptionally hostile environment. Temperatures range from minus 180 to 450 degrees Celsius, while solar radiation can reach ten times the level found on Earth. The spacecraft’s solar panels create one of the tightest margins. They must generate enough electricity while avoiding direct heating from the Sun. A slight change in angle can either cut power or cause the panels to overheat and deteriorate.

Much of the technology, including the power supply, thermal protection and control systems, has never faced these conditions in operation. Santa Martinez, the mission manager, says the team expects that not everything will follow the plan and is prepared to adapt.

If the probes succeed, scientists could finally examine the planet we know least about among the rocky worlds. Cameras will map its surface in high resolution, including mysterious depressions that appear to be caused by volatile substances escaping as gas. Craters near the north pole may also contain ice because sunlight never reaches their floors, even though the surrounding surface exceeds 400 degrees Celsius.

Launched from ESA’s spaceport in French Guiana on Oct. 20, 2018, BepiColombo has already flown past Earth once and Venus twice. The mission consists of ESA’s Mercury Planetary Orbiter and Japan’s Mio probe, which will study Mercury and its surrounding space environment.
